1.
This matter is taken by video conferencing mode. 2.
Heard Miss. S.Rath, learned Additional Standing Counsel for the Appellants and Mrs.P.Rath, learned counsel for the Respondent. Gone through the orders dated 18.04.2019 and 25.04.2019 as also the documents filed in connection with the same.
3.
It is seen that the parties have arrived at a settlement as to full and final satisfaction of the claim of the Respondent No.1 (Plaintiff) on payment of Rs.2,60,000/- (Rupees Two Lakh Sixty Thousand) by the Appellants (Defendants) to the Respondent (Plaintiff). The counsels also so submit on that score of settlement as above.
In view of the above, the Appeal stands disposed of with the modification of decrees passed by the Courts below that the Appellants (Defendants) are liable to pay Rs.2,60,000/-
// 2 // to the Respondent (Plaintiff) with interest @ 12% per annum with effect from today within a period of three months. It is, however, made clear that in the event, the payment, as aforesaid, is not made within the time stipulated; the said amount would carry interest @ 18% per annum from today till payment.
4 .
The Appeal is accordingly disposed of without cost.
